An overactive thyroid, or hyperthyroidism, accelerates the body's metabolism, affecting numerous systems, including the cardiovascular system. This heightened state makes individuals particularly sensitive to certain medications and supplements. Interactions can worsen symptoms like a rapid heartbeat, anxiety, and weight loss, and in some cases, can trigger a life-threatening complication called a thyroid storm. Both prescription and over-the-counter (OTC) drugs carry risks that demand careful attention. Consulting with a healthcare provider before starting any new medication is paramount for individuals with hyperthyroidism.
Prescription Medications to Avoid or Use with Caution
Certain prescription drugs are known to interfere with thyroid function or exacerbate hyperthyroid symptoms. For some, the risks are due to high iodine content, while others affect hormonal pathways or have stimulating side effects.
Iodine-Rich Drugs
- Amiodarone: This potent anti-arrhythmic medication, used for heart rhythm disorders, contains extremely high levels of iodine, which can be 50 to 100 times the daily recommended intake. In individuals with hyperthyroidism, this excess iodine can trigger or worsen the condition. Regular thyroid monitoring is essential for anyone taking amiodarone.
- Contrast Media: Certain X-ray contrast agents, used during imaging procedures, contain high levels of iodine. For patients with pre-existing thyroid nodules, this can cause an overproduction of thyroid hormones, leading to or exacerbating hyperthyroidism. Your doctor should be aware of your thyroid status before you undergo any such tests.
Cancer and Immunotherapy Medications
- Immune Checkpoint Inhibitors: Used in cancer treatment, these drugs (such as nivolumab and pembrolizumab) can induce immune-related adverse effects, including thyroid dysfunction like Graves' disease.
- Alemtuzumab: Another cancer medication, alemtuzumab, has been linked to an increased risk of developing Graves' disease.
- Interferon-alpha: This medication, used for chronic hepatitis C, can lead to thyroid disease, including hyperthyroidism, in a significant percentage of patients.
Psychiatric and Other Medications
- Lithium: Used as a mood stabilizer, lithium can affect thyroid function, and in rare cases, lead to hyperthyroidism or Graves' disease.
- Sympathomimetics: Medications like epinephrine, sometimes used in local anesthetics or for other cardiac issues, can cause cardiovascular stimulation that is dangerous for severely hyperthyroid individuals.
- Estrogens: Oral contraceptives and hormone replacement therapy containing estrogen can increase thyroxine-binding globulin (TBG), potentially altering thyroid hormone levels and requiring dosage adjustments.
Over-the-Counter (OTC) Drugs and Supplements to Avoid
Even common, non-prescription products can pose significant risks for individuals with hyperthyroidism.
OTC Drugs
- Decongestants: Many cold, flu, and allergy remedies contain decongestants like pseudoephedrine or phenylephrine. These can increase heart rate and blood pressure, posing a risk of cardiac complications for those with an already accelerated cardiovascular system due to hyperthyroidism.
- Iodine-Containing Products: Some cough syrups and skin antiseptics (like povidone-iodine) contain iodine. Excess iodine intake can trigger or worsen hyperthyroidism, especially in susceptible individuals.
Supplements
- Excessive Iodine and Kelp: High-dose iodine supplements or kelp-based products should be strictly avoided. While iodine is essential, excessive amounts can cause the thyroid gland to produce too much hormone.
- L-Tyrosine: This amino acid is a precursor to thyroid hormones. Supplementing with L-tyrosine can increase hormone production, which is detrimental for hyperthyroid patients.
- Licorice Extract and Other Herbs: Licorice extract can increase cortisol levels, which is not ideal for hyperthyroidism management. Other herbs like celery extract have also been shown to affect thyroid function.
- Over-the-Counter Thyroid Glandular Supplements: These are unregulated and contain unpredictable amounts of animal thyroid hormone, which can worsen hormone imbalances and interact negatively with other medications.
- Biotin: While not directly harmful to the thyroid, high doses of biotin can interfere with thyroid lab tests, leading to inaccurate results. Patients should stop taking biotin at least a few days before having their thyroid levels tested.

Medication Comparison: Safe vs. Risky Choices for Hyperthyroidism
Medication Category | Risky/Contraindicated Examples | Safe/Alternative Examples |
---|---|---|
Heart Rhythm Drugs | Amiodarone | Beta-blockers (e.g., atenolol, propranolol) are used therapeutically to manage hyperthyroid symptoms. |
Decongestants | Pseudoephedrine, Phenylephrine (many OTC cold/flu formulas) | Saline nasal sprays, humidifiers, or steam inhalation for congestion. |
Supplements | High-dose Iodine, Kelp, L-Tyrosine | Selenium, provided it is not in excess, and under a doctor's supervision. |
Imaging Agents | Iodine-containing contrast media | Non-iodinated contrast agents (MRI with gadolinium contrast). |
Pain Relievers | High-dose Salicylates (aspirin) | Standard doses of acetaminophen (Tylenol). |
